什么是数据库完整性截图

worktile 其他 8

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库完整性是指数据库中数据的准确性、一致性和有效性。截图是指在数据库设计和管理过程中使用的一种工具或方法,用于确保数据库的完整性。数据库完整性截图是通过对数据库中的数据进行截图或快照,以检查和验证数据的完整性。

    以下是数据库完整性截图的五个关键点:

    1. 数据类型检查:数据库完整性截图可以检查数据类型是否正确。例如,在一个存储员工信息的数据库中,如果员工的年龄字段是整数类型,截图可以检查该字段是否只包含整数值,以确保数据的准确性。

    2. 唯一性检查:数据库完整性截图可以检查数据的唯一性。例如,在一个存储客户订单的数据库中,截图可以检查订单号字段是否唯一,以避免重复的订单号出现。

    3. 外键约束检查:数据库完整性截图可以检查外键约束是否正确。外键是用来建立不同表之间的关系的字段,截图可以检查外键字段是否与主表的主键字段相对应,以确保数据的一致性。

    4. 空值检查:数据库完整性截图可以检查空值的存在。空值是指字段中没有值的情况,截图可以检查字段是否有必要的值,以确保数据的有效性。

    5. 触发器和约束检查:数据库完整性截图可以检查触发器和约束是否正确。触发器和约束是用来限制和控制数据库中数据的操作和行为的,截图可以检查触发器和约束是否按照预期执行,以确保数据的完整性。

    通过数据库完整性截图,可以及时发现和纠正数据库中的数据错误和问题,确保数据的准确性、一致性和有效性。这是数据库设计和管理中非常重要的一个环节。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库完整性是指数据库中数据的准确性和一致性。数据库完整性约束是一组规则,用于确保数据库中的数据满足特定的条件。截图是指将数据库完整性约束的定义和设置以图像的形式进行展示和记录。

    在数据库中,完整性约束有以下几种类型:

    1. 实体完整性:确保每个表中的每一行都具有唯一的标识,一般通过主键来实现。主键是一个唯一标识符,用于标识表中的每一行数据。

    2. 参照完整性:确保表之间的关系是有效的。在关系型数据库中,通过外键来实现参照完整性。外键是一个指向其他表的字段,它确保在主表中的数据必须在引用表中存在。

    3. 域完整性:确保数据的取值范围是有效的。数据库中的字段可以设置数据类型、长度、约束条件等,以确保数据的有效性和一致性。

    4. 用户定义的完整性:根据具体业务需求,用户可以定义自己的完整性约束条件,以确保数据满足特定的条件。

    截图是一种将数据库完整性约束以图像的形式展示的方式,通常用于记录和展示数据库设计和结构。截图可以包括表的字段、主键、外键等信息,并标注各个完整性约束的设置和定义。通过截图,用户可以直观地了解数据库的结构和完整性约束的设置,方便进行数据库的维护和管理。

    数据库完整性截图可以通过数据库管理工具来生成,例如MySQL Workbench、Navicat等。这些工具提供了可视化的界面,用户可以通过简单的操作来设计和管理数据库,并生成相应的截图。截图可以保存为图片文件,方便在文档或报告中使用。

    总之,数据库完整性截图是将数据库中的完整性约束以图像的形式展示和记录,用于展示数据库结构和约束条件的一种方式,方便数据库的管理和维护。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库完整性是指数据库中数据的准确性和一致性。数据库完整性截图是一种通过截取数据库的结构和数据来验证数据库完整性的方法。它可以用于验证数据库中的数据是否符合预期的规则和约束,以确保数据的一致性和正确性。

    数据库完整性截图通常包括以下几个步骤:

    1. 确定数据库完整性规则:在进行数据库完整性截图之前,首先需要确定数据库中的完整性规则。这些规则可以是由数据库管理员或开发人员定义的,用于限制数据库中数据的范围和约束条件。例如,可以定义某个字段的取值范围、唯一性约束、外键关联等。

    2. 创建数据库完整性截图:在确定了数据库的完整性规则之后,就可以开始创建数据库完整性截图。这可以通过使用数据库管理系统提供的工具或编写脚本来完成。截图可以包括数据库的表结构、字段定义、索引、触发器、存储过程等信息,以及数据的示例值。

    3. 校验数据库完整性:完成数据库完整性截图后,需要对数据库进行校验以确保数据的完整性。这可以通过比对截图中的数据和实际数据库中的数据来完成。如果截图中的数据与实际数据库中的数据一致,则说明数据库的完整性得到了保证;如果存在不一致的情况,则需要进行相应的修复操作。

    4. 处理数据不一致问题:如果在校验过程中发现了数据不一致的问题,需要对数据库进行相应的修复操作。修复操作可以包括修改数据、删除无效数据、添加缺失数据等。修复操作应该根据具体的问题进行,确保数据库的数据达到预期的完整性要求。

    总结:

    数据库完整性截图是一种验证数据库完整性的方法,通过截取数据库的结构和数据来验证数据的准确性和一致性。它可以帮助数据库管理员和开发人员确保数据库中的数据符合预期的规则和约束条件,保证数据的一致性和正确性。完成数据库完整性截图后,需要对数据库进行校验,并对数据不一致的问题进行修复操作,以达到预期的完整性要求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部